  3. STING-IN-17

STING-IN-17 是一种口服活性的 STING (人源 STING IC50 = 29 nM, 鼠源 STING IC50 = 15 nM) 抑制剂。STING-IN-17 可以抑制 STINGTBK1、IRF3 的磷酸化。STING-IN-17 剂量依赖性抑制 IP10、IFNB1、ISG56 mRNA 表达。STING-IN-17 可以减少 ROS 并抑制 cleaved-PARP/caspase-3 表达。STING-IN-17 可以改善肾功能。STING-IN-17 可以用于急性肾损伤等炎症性疾病的研究。

生物活性

STING-IN-17 is an orally active STING (human STING IC50 = 29 nM, mouse STING IC50 = 15 nM) inhibitor. STING-IN-17 can inhibit the phosphorylation of STING, TBK1 and IRF3. STING-IN-17 dose dependently inhibits the mRNA expression of IP10, IFNB1 and ISG56. STING-IN-17 can reduce ROS and inhibit the expression of cleaved-PARP/caspase-3. STING-IN-17 can improve kidney function. STING-IN-17 can be used for research on inflammatory conditions such as acute kidney injury[1].
